Based on our analysis of NIST CSF 2.0 coverage, core features, integrations, company size fit, here is our conclusion:
Mid-market and enterprise teams protecting shared or high-touch workstations should consider GateKeeper Enterprise for its proximity-based automatic lock-unlock, which eliminates the friction of manual MFA while maintaining audit trails on who accessed what. The on-premises deployment with SQL-backed credential storage and Active Directory integration appeals to organizations with strict data residency requirements, and the NIST PR.AA coverage reflects solid identity and access control enforcement. This is not the right choice if you need cloud-native SSO, browser extension support across all applications, or cloud-hosted credential management; GateKeeper's strength is physical workstation security for defined user populations, not distributed workforce scenarios.
SMB and mid-market IT teams replacing password-based Windows login will cut phishing attacks at the perimeter with Idenprotect for Windows, since biometric authentication on employee mobile devices eliminates the credential reuse that makes credential stuffing work. The tool supports both cloud and on-premises AD integration, offline TOTP fallback, and VDI sessions, so it handles the hybrid infrastructure most organizations actually run. Skip this if you need passwordless authentication across non-Windows systems or require deep integration with identity governance platforms beyond basic SIEM log export.

GateKeeper Enterprise: Proximity-based MFA & password mgmt platform for enterprise workstations. built by GateKeeper Enterprise. headquartered in United States. Core capabilities include Proximity-based automatic workstation lock and unlock using wireless hardware tokens, Centralized management console for users, passwords, and computers, Audit logs for all access-related events with on-demand reporting..
Idenprotect for Windows: Passwordless, phishing-resistant Windows login via mobile biometrics. built by Idenprotect. headquartered in United Kingdom. Core capabilities include Passwordless Windows login via mobile biometric authentication, Out-of-band authentication using Idenprotect Passport mobile app, Offline authentication via time-based OTP (TOTP)..
